How to Age a Goat
Like 4 Dislike 0 Published on 2 Oct 2018
If you are keeping meat goats as a farm business it's important to have an idea of how old your goats are. The best way to age a goat is to learn about their bottom teeth. These teeth will tell you a lot about your goats age and breeding life.
